Why Should You Regularly Measure TDS in Your Hot Tub Water?

Regularly measuring Total Dissolved Solids (TDS) in your hot tub water is essential because elevated TDS levels can lead to water quality issues, affecting both user comfort and the longevity of the hot tub’s components.

According to the Centers for Disease Control and Prevention (CDC), water with high TDS can harbor contaminants that may cause skin irritation and other health concerns. Monitoring TDS helps keep the water safe and pleasant for users, as it reflects the concentration of dissolved substances like minerals, salts, and pollutants in the water.

The underlying mechanism behind TDS accumulation involves the continuous introduction of various substances into the hot tub water, such as body oils, lotions, and even chemicals used for sanitization. Over time, these substances accumulate, leading to increased TDS levels. When TDS levels rise significantly, it can inhibit the effectiveness of sanitizers, making it more difficult to maintain clean and safe water. This can further lead to scaling on the heater and other components, which can be costly to repair or replace.

Additionally, high TDS levels can alter the water’s chemical balance, affecting pH and alkalinity. As a result, maintaining a proper balance becomes increasingly challenging, which can create a cycle of poor water quality. Regularly measuring TDS allows hot tub owners to take timely corrective actions, ensuring a healthier and more enjoyable experience while extending the lifespan of the hot tub system.

What Accuracy Level Should You Expect from a TDS Meter?

The accuracy level of a TDS meter can vary based on the quality and design of the device, as well as its intended application.

  • Standard Accuracy (±2% to ±5%): Most budget-friendly TDS meters fall within this accuracy range, making them suitable for general use.
  • High Accuracy (±1%): More advanced TDS meters designed for laboratory or professional use can achieve a higher level of accuracy, beneficial for precise readings.
  • Calibration Frequency: Regular calibration is essential for maintaining accuracy, as it ensures the meter is providing correct measurements over time.
  • Temperature Compensation: Some TDS meters come with automatic temperature compensation, which enhances accuracy by adjusting readings based on water temperature.
  • Resolution: The resolution of a TDS meter, often expressed in parts per million (ppm), can affect perceived accuracy; higher resolution meters provide more precise readings.

Standard accuracy is typical for most consumer-grade TDS meters, which are adequate for everyday tasks like monitoring hot tub water quality. These meters generally offer a margin of error between ±2% to ±5%, which is acceptable for casual users needing a general idea of total dissolved solids levels.

High accuracy meters, on the other hand, are aimed at professionals who require precise data for scientific or technical applications. With an accuracy of ±1%, these devices can detect subtle changes in TDS levels, making them ideal for more sensitive environments, such as laboratories or aquariums.

Calibration frequency is critical for ensuring ongoing accuracy since TDS meters can drift over time due to usage. Regular calibration against a known standard is recommended to help maintain the integrity of measurements, especially if the meter is used frequently.

Temperature compensation is a feature that many modern TDS meters include, allowing them to adjust for temperature fluctuations that can affect readings. This is particularly useful in hot tubs, where water temperatures can vary significantly and impact the conductivity of the water.

Lastly, the resolution of a TDS meter, which indicates the smallest change it can detect, is also a key factor in its accuracy. Meters with higher resolution can provide more detailed insights into water quality, which can be crucial for maintaining optimal conditions in a hot tub environment.

What Is the Ideal TDS Level for a Hot Tub Environment?

According to the World Health Organization (WHO), TDS levels in drinking water should ideally be below 500 mg/L for optimal health and palatability. While this guideline primarily applies to drinking water, it serves as a useful benchmark for hot tub environments as well, where recommended TDS levels typically range between 300 to 1500 mg/L, depending on the specific features of the hot tub and the frequency of use.

Key aspects of TDS in a hot tub include its impact on water clarity, equipment longevity, and user comfort. High TDS levels can lead to cloudy water, scaling on surfaces and heaters, and reduced effectiveness of sanitizers like chlorine or bromine. Regularly monitoring TDS helps maintain optimal water balance, ensuring that pH and alkalinity levels are also kept in check, which is crucial for preventing skin irritation and ensuring a pleasant soaking experience.

This impacts not only the aesthetic quality of the hot tub water but also the health and safety of users. Elevated TDS levels may harbor pathogens or contaminants that could lead to skin infections or other health issues. Moreover, the effectiveness of chemical treatments diminishes as TDS increases, necessitating more frequent adjustments and maintenance, which can lead to increased costs and time investment for owners.

Best practices for managing TDS in hot tubs include regular water testing and maintenance. Utilizing a reliable TDS meter can help owners monitor levels accurately, allowing for timely water changes or adjustments to chemical treatments. The best TDS meters for hot tubs are those that provide quick and precise readings, often featuring digital displays and user-friendly interfaces. It’s also advisable to perform water changes every 3-4 months, depending on usage, to maintain TDS levels within the recommended range and ensure a safe and enjoyable hot tub experience.

How Can You Properly Calibrate and Maintain Your TDS Meter for the Best Results?

Proper calibration and maintenance of your TDS meter are essential for ensuring accurate readings, especially when monitoring water quality in a hot tub.

  • Calibration Solutions: Use high-quality calibration solutions specifically designed for TDS meters.
  • Regular Calibration Schedule: Establish a routine calibration schedule based on usage frequency and environmental conditions.
  • Cleaning Procedures: Implement proper cleaning procedures for the probe to avoid contamination and buildup.
  • Storage Conditions: Store your TDS meter in appropriate conditions to protect it from damage and ensure longevity.
  • Battery Maintenance: Check and replace batteries as needed to avoid inaccurate readings due to low power.

The calibration solutions should have known TDS values and be used to ensure that your meter provides accurate readings. Generally, a two-point calibration is recommended, using solutions that bracket the expected range of TDS in your hot tub water.

Establishing a regular calibration schedule, such as monthly or bi-monthly, can help maintain accuracy over time. Environmental factors like temperature and humidity can affect readings, so calibrating under consistent conditions is ideal.

Proper cleaning of the probe is crucial; rinse it with distilled water after each use and periodically clean it with a soft cloth or appropriate solution to remove any deposits that might affect measurement accuracy.

Store your TDS meter in a protective case or a stable environment away from extreme temperatures and direct sunlight to prevent damage to its sensitive components. This ensures that the meter remains functional and reliable for an extended period.

Finally, regularly check the batteries and replace them when they show signs of weakness, as low battery power can lead to inaccurate readings. Keeping your meter powered will help maintain optimal performance for monitoring your hot tub water quality.

What Common Mistakes Do Hot Tub Owners Make When Using TDS Meters?

Common mistakes that hot tub owners make when using TDS meters include improper calibration, neglecting regular testing, and misunderstanding TDS readings.

  • Improper Calibration: Many hot tub owners fail to calibrate their TDS meters before use, which can lead to inaccurate readings. Calibration ensures that the meter provides precise measurements by aligning it with a known standard, and skipping this step can result in misleading data about water quality.
  • Neglecting Regular Testing: Some owners only test TDS levels occasionally, which can overlook significant fluctuations that occur due to usage and environmental factors. Regular testing is essential for maintaining optimal water quality and preventing issues such as scaling or corrosion in the hot tub.
  • Misunderstanding TDS Readings: There is often confusion about what TDS readings actually indicate, leading to incorrect conclusions about water quality. High TDS levels do not always mean that the water is unsafe; they simply indicate the concentration of dissolved solids, and it’s important to understand what those solids are to take appropriate action.
  • Ignoring Other Water Quality Parameters: Relying solely on TDS measurements can lead to overlooking other critical factors such as pH, alkalinity, and sanitizer levels. A comprehensive approach to water management is necessary for ensuring the hot tub is safe and enjoyable, as TDS alone does not provide a complete picture of water conditions.
  • Using Incompatible Meters: Some owners may use TDS meters not specifically designed for hot tubs, leading to inaccurate results. It is crucial to choose a meter that is suitable for the specific water conditions of a hot tub, as different environments can affect the performance of the meter.
